Low Level Function
1.4.2 Credit Operator's Account

Overview

This Function shall be capable of providing the following facilities:

(1) The ability to credit the accounts of the Service Operators by the amount that has already been calculated.
(2) The ability to receive the calculated creidt amount from the functionality that distributes fees revenue.

Functional Requirements

(a) read the different elements included in the message coming from "Distribute Fee Revenues".
(b) sends the credit order to the financial clearinghouse, including the fee, the originating account, and the account to be credited,
(c) load the transaction into the store of "transactions" Data.

Diagrams

The Diagram(s) is (are) the diagram(s) where you can find the function :
  • DFD 1.4 Manage Operators' Revenue
  • Functional Tree of Area 1
  • Parent Higher Level Function

    Input logical dataflows

    Output logical dataflows

    User needs

    Number

    Description

    4.1.2.1
    The system shall be able to share revenues between road network operators.
    4.1.2.2
    The system shall enable a single payment to be paid for services offered by different related transport systems (e.g. metro, bus, train, road and parking).
    4.1.3.2
    The system shall make atomic electronic financial transactions, I.e. that are never partially complete whatever the circumstances, even in degraded system modes.
    4.1.3.3
    The system shall have the maximum security necessary for electronic financial transactions.
    4.1.3.4
    The system shall have a low number of incorrect transactions (e.g., non-effective transactions < 1 in 10E-6; erroneous transactions < 1 in 10E-8)